The Psychology of Persistence: Why We Keep Playing
The addictive nature of chickenroads-ca.ca isn’t solely attributable to its engaging gameplay. A key component is the psychological principle of variable ratio reinforcement. This means that rewards (successfully crossing the road and earning points) are given unpredictably, making the experience far more compelling. Unlike games where rewards are granted consistently, the uncertainty of when the next success will arrive keeps players hooked, constantly striving for that next satisfying moment. The feeling of narrowly avoiding a collision also triggers a dopamine release, reinforcing the behavior and making players want to repeat the experience. It's this subtle manipulation of our reward system that creates a compelling loop of challenge and satisfaction.
